> Hi Brandon,
> Yes, it is in that general time frame. The game actually begins a little
> while after Revenge of the Syth. You play the part of Jedi Learner, Olee
> Starstone, and by luck you escaped Order 66. Now, you are on a single
> minded quest to defeat the Empire.
> The game features a series of minibosses and bosses. You will fight
> minibosses like Clone Commanders, and bigger bosses like Moff Tarken,
> Darth Vader, and Emperor Palpatine himself.
> One feature I want to do with Starstone is give you the option to play
> as a dark sider or light sider. With similar but slightly alternative
> storylines.
> The light side story is this. After the Clone Wars Olee Starstone, now
> one of the last of the Jedi, realises it is up to her to save the galaxy
> from the galactic Empire. Starstone travels the galaxy attempting to
> foil the Empire's plans to launch a new and powerful super weapon, and
> defeat Darth vader and Emperor Palpatine.
> The dark side story is similar, but requires vengence. You are Olee
> Starstone, and you have lost everything. that mattered. Your friends,
> teachers, station in life, are all gone. Bitter and angry she travels
> the galaxy seaking Revenge against the Empire, and as she does so she
> becomes a powerful dark force wielding master able to cast lightning,
> force choke, force distruction, and if she defeats Emperor Palpatine she
> will be come the new Emperess of the galaxy.
> The alternative storyline and ending is something I am using from Jedi
> Knight. I always like the concept of choosing sides. I especially liked
> if you were in a dark mood going around frying enemies with force
> lightning, and even wacking inocent civilians. I remember one seen in
> Jedi Knight a guy who needs rescued, and I come along and fry him with
> lightning causing him to fall to his doom.
